UPSRTC mows five, injures two in Noida

Noida, May 11: A speeding Uttar Pradesh State Road Transport Corporation (UPSRTC) bus killed at least five people, including a minor, and injured two others severely in Sector 35 here. The mishap occurred around 0030 hrs at Morna village, where driver Satpal Singh hit seven labourers sleeping near the UP Roadways boundary wall which was being renovated, killing five of them instantly, Superintendent of Police (City) Mahesh Kumar Mishra said today.

The driver is absconding and a manhunt had been launched, he added. The injured, both minors, were battling for life at Guru Teg Bahadur Hospital and district hospital. The deceased had been identified as Kude (48), Sugar Bai (45), Hari Bai (16), Gulab (7) and Tunda (40), all residents of Madhya Pradesh. Meanwhile, an ex-gratia of Rs 50,000 respectively had been announced by both the UPSRTC and Gautam Buddha Nagar district administration to kin of those killed in the accident.

Bodies had been sent for autopsy.
